Output 7c53f3f08896f46c40b9422f8ebbabbd2d5a75e2fcb64a665467b99f91d4d9c7:0

value
26844931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ac8cc066c0279cce468d9e92fa791699452c270 OP_EQUAL
address
3ELqidm8JKUWBfKJYCuXiBsJxAT5fysLX5
transaction
7c53f3f08896f46c40b9422f8ebbabbd2d5a75e2fcb64a665467b99f91d4d9c7
confirmations
472525
spent
true